Abstract: A unipolar living tissue stimulator of the implantable type with an outer plate electrode which in one embodiment consists of a flat metal plate slotted by slots to form a plurality of electrically conductive strips. Each strip is electrically in contact with any other strip through only a single path. The strips are dimensioned so that any substantially square or circular surface area on any strip is significantly smaller than the total conductive surface area of the plate. Consequently, the heating of the slotted plate due to an external alternating magnetic field is reduced significantly.
